AlertmanagerWebhookPayload
public struct AlertmanagerWebhookPayload : Content
Prometheus Alertmanager webhook payload. Applied from https://prometheus.io/docs/alerting/latest/configuration/#webhook_config
-
Declaration
Swift
var version: String -
Key identifying the group of alerts (e.g. to deduplicate).
Declaration
Swift
var groupKey: String -
How many alerts have been truncated due to “max_alerts”.
Declaration
Swift
var truncatedAlerts: Int -
Declaration
Swift
var status: String -
Declaration
Swift
var receiver: String -
Declaration
Swift
var groupLabels: [String : String] -
Declaration
Swift
var commonLabels: [String : String] -
Declaration
Swift
var commonAnnotations: [String : String] -
backlink to the Alertmanager.
Declaration
Swift
var externalURL: String -
Declaration
Swift
var alerts: [AlertmanagerAlert]
View on GitHub